Ecoplans Limited's landscape architecture group has been working in conjunction with MRC engineers and NORR Limited architects on the revitalization plans for the Blue Water Bridge boarder crossing in Point Edward. Our landscape architects have been retained to update the preliminarily landscape master plan as well as provide detailed design for Phase 1 of the plaza improvements.
The concept for the plaza is based on the Lake Huron shoreline; the landscape aims to evoke the coastal dune imagery of the region by creating a rolling topography planted with a series of grasses which will provide movement and texture to the landscape.
Phase 1 of the improvements aims to be LEED (Leadership in Energy and Environmental Design) Green Building Rating System accredited. LEED promotes a whole-building/site approach to sustainability by recognizing performance in key areas of human and environmental health such as sustainable site development, water savings, and energy efficiency.
